网上邻居无权访问怎么回事?
在局域网内安装了Windows XP的电脑不能与安装了Windows 98的电脑互相访问,安装了Windows XP的电脑与安装了Windows XP的电脑也不能互相通信。在工作站访问服务器时,工作站的“网上邻居”中可以看到服务器的名称,但是点击后却无法看到任何共享内容,且提示“无权查看”,这种故障是怎么出现的呢?分析一下,首先在工作站可以看到服务器的名称,这说明硬件是没有问题的,那么就应该考虑是否由于软件设置不当(如网络协议错误)造成。 如果在检查了服务器的所有协议后发现设置正常,那么就应该考虑是否为Windows的安全特性的设置问题,根据以往的经验并参考了网上的一些资料,总结起来有下...全部
在局域网内安装了Windows XP的电脑不能与安装了Windows 98的电脑互相访问,安装了Windows XP的电脑与安装了Windows XP的电脑也不能互相通信。在工作站访问服务器时,工作站的“网上邻居”中可以看到服务器的名称,但是点击后却无法看到任何共享内容,且提示“无权查看”,这种故障是怎么出现的呢?分析一下,首先在工作站可以看到服务器的名称,这说明硬件是没有问题的,那么就应该考虑是否由于软件设置不当(如网络协议错误)造成。
如果在检查了服务器的所有协议后发现设置正常,那么就应该考虑是否为Windows的安全特性的设置问题,根据以往的经验并参考了网上的一些资料,总结起来有下面这么几点:一是开启GUEST账号;二是安装NetBEUI协议;三是关闭xp中自带的网络防火墙;四是设置共享文件夹;五是打开组策略编辑器。
本地计算机策略→计算机配置→Windows设置→安全设置→本地策略→用户权利指派”,在右边找到“拒绝从网络访问这台计算机”这一项。双击该项,在弹出的属性对话框中如果看到有Guest用户被禁止从网络访问的话,删除Guest用户。
六运行网络标识向导。我的电脑选择“属性”,然后单击“计算机名”选项卡单击“网络 ID”按钮,开始“网络标识向导”:单击“下一步”,选择“本机是商业网络的一部分,用它连接到其他工作着的计算机”;单击“下一步”,选择“公司使用没有域的网络”;单击“下一步”按钮,然后输入你的局域网的工作组名,再次单击“下一步”按钮,最后单击“完成”按钮完成设置。
解除Windows XP的文件共享限制 笔者的很多朋友都曾遇到过这样的问题:在安装了Windows XP的计算机上,即使网络连接和共享设置正确(如IP地址属于同一子网,启用了TCP/IP上的NetBIOS,防火墙软件没有禁止文件共享需要的135、137、138、139等端口),使用其他系统(包括Windows 9X/Me/2000/XP等)的用户仍然无法访问该计算机。
我们应该怎样解决这一问题呢? 默认情况下,Windows XP的本地安全设置要求进行网络访问的用户全部采用来宾方式。同时,在Windows XP安全策略的用户权利指派中又禁止Guest用户通过网络访问系统。
这样两条相互矛盾的安全策略导致了网内其他用户无法通过网络访问使用Windows XP的计算机。你可采用以下方法解决。 方法一 解除对Guest账号的限制 点击“开始→运行”,在“运行”对话框中输入“GPEDIT。
MSC”,打开组策略编辑器,依次选择“计算机配置→Windows设置→安全设置→本地策略→用户权利指派”,双击“拒绝从网络访问这台计算机”策略,删除里面的“GUEST”账号。这样其他用户就能够用Guest账号通过网络访问使用Windows XP系统的计算机了。
方法二 更改网络访问模式 打开组策略编辑器,依次选择“计算机配置→Windows设置→安全设置→本地策略→安全选项”,双击“网络访问:本地账号的共享和安全模式”策略,将默认设置“仅来宾—本地用户以来宾身份验证”,更改为“经典:本地用户以自己的身份验证”。
现在,当其他用户通过网络访问使用Windows XP的计算机时,就可以用自己的“身份”进行登录了(前提是Windows XP中已有这个账号并且口令是正确的)。 当该策略改变后,文件的共享方式也有所变化,在启用“经典:本地用户以自己的身份验证”方式后,我们可以对同时访问共享文件的用户数量进行限制,并能针对不同用户设置不同的访问权限。
不过我们可能还会遇到另外一个问题,当用户的口令为空时,访问还是会被拒绝。原来在“安全选项”中有一个“账户:使用空白密码的本地账户只允许进行控制台登录”策略默认是启用的,根据Windows XP安全策略中拒绝优先的原则,密码为空的用户通过网络访问使用Windows XP的计算机时便会被禁止。
我们只要将这个策略停用即可解决问题。收起